When installing on a system with more than one hard drive, the default installation does not ask which drive trixbox should be installed on. This is somewhat dangerous.

I know there is a warning saying the system will be reformatted, but it wuold be helpful if it said something like "If you wish to specify which drive trixbox will be installed on, or a custom partioning scheme you must select an advanced install".

I was expecting it so reformat the system drive, but I was gobsmacked to see it start formatting my data drive without asking me which drive to install onto.

I was upgrading from trixbox

I was upgrading from trixbox 2.2 to the latest which requires a reinstall. My data drive had 6 months worth of call recordings from my call-centre on it (190,000 calls) and the MySQL databases. I'd intentionally moved these off my system drive thinking they would be safe.

I've never before in my life installed an operating system without being given a choice about where it was to be installed. I'll be more careful next time!

Fortunately it had only just started formatting my data drive and it looks like I can recover most of my recordings!
